I got a 460 out of a lincoln bout a 75 model and wanted to know if its possible to strip off the a/c compressor and the power steering and it still be fine, also my basic question is can i use the same ignition system that is currently on my 68 f100 and fire it up and it run right it is carburated, but was wondering if anyone had done this and what types of issues they ran into, i have the mounts and perches and towers and all to sit it in problem is i want it to run when it does

It should be fine without the a/c and p/s.

Not sure on the ignition system. If they both run the same kind it should work, but I dont' know if they are both points style or newer... Depends on the distributor mainly.

Is your '68 a 460 also?
